About agriculture in Oakley

Oakley is situated in the Mpumalanga province of South Africa, nestled within the scenic Lowveld region. The surrounding landscape is characterized by rolling hills, lush subtropical vegetation, and proximity to the world-renowned Kruger National Park. The rural area features a mix of communal grazing lands and organized commercial farming estates, benefiting from the region's warm climate and seasonal rainfall.

The agricultural sector in the Oakley area is diverse, with a strong focus on subtropical fruit production. Local farms cultivate a variety of crops including citrus, mangoes, and avocados, which thrive in the frost-free environment. Additionally, there are significant commercial forestry operations and livestock farming, particularly cattle and goats, which utilize the natural grasslands of the Lowveld.
